Industrial Tar Surfacing Rates
Industrial tar surfacing rates differ across Gauteng’s major industrial hubs. For large-scale projects over 500 m², costs range from R90 to R150 per square metre. This pricing reflects the durability needed for high-traffic industrial areas.
Manufacturing facility paving needs specialised solutions for heavy machinery and frequent vehicle movement. Costs can be higher, especially when chemical resistance and load-bearing requirements are considered.
Distribution centre surfacing faces challenges due to constant lorry traffic and loading activities. These projects may need extra reinforcement, pushing costs towards R150 per square metre.
| Application | Average Cost (per m²) | Key Considerations |
|---|---|---|
| Industrial Park Roads | R90-R120 | Traffic volume, drainage |
| Manufacturing Facility Paving | R110-R150 | Chemical resistance, load-bearing capacity |
| Distribution Centre Surfacing | R100-R140 | Frequent heavy vehicle traffic, durability |
| Industrial Complex Paving | R95-R130 | Varied use, flexibility in design |
Hot Mix Asphalt application is vital for industrial complex paving. It requires temperatures of 150 to 170 °C for a durable bond. This process adds to the cost but ensures longevity under harsh industrial conditions.

Maintenance and Longevity Considerations – Industrial Tar Surfacing Rates
Proper upkeep is vital for industrial tar surfaces. It ensures their longevity and top performance. Let’s examine key maintenance practices and their effects on durability and costs.
Preventive Maintenance Schedules
Regular checks and minor fixes prevent major issues. They also extend the life of the surface. A good plan includes yearly assessments, crack sealing, and levelling.
These practices can greatly reduce maintenance costs over time. They help keep the surface in top shape for longer.
Surface Repair Protocols
Quick action on cracks and potholes is crucial. Repair methods depend on how bad the damage is. For large areas, fixing potholes can cost R50 to R100 per square metre yearly.
Swift repairs stop further damage. They keep the surface strong and intact.
Long-term Cost Benefits
Quality tar surfacing and regular care lead to big savings. The initial cost might seem high. But it means fewer repairs and a longer-lasting surface.
When planning commercial paving, think about these long-term gains. They can make a big difference to your budget.
| Maintenance Type | Frequency | Cost (per sq m) |
|---|---|---|
| Inspection | Annually | R10-R20 |
| Crack Sealing | Every 2-3 years | R30-R50 |
| Resurfacing | Every 7-10 years | R200-R300 |
Grasping these upkeep factors helps you plan for your surface’s whole life. Regular care and prompt fixes boost your investment’s value. They ensure your surface works well for years to come.

8. What is the typical lifespan of an industrial tar surface?
With proper installation and maintenance, industrial tar surfaces can last 15 to 25 years. Lifespan varies based on usage, maintenance, and environmental conditions. High-traffic areas or surfaces exposed to harsh chemicals may need more frequent resurfacing.
